Socks If you wear properly fitting shoes with cotton socks you are more likely to develop blisters. Technical socks wick moisture from your feet and hold their shape. You should not feel the seams that shape the heel and close the toe of a sock. We have no-show, quarter, and crew lengths in various weights. We also have socks from Injinji, like gloves for your feet, these innovative "toe socks" virtually prevent blisters with seamless construction that protects each toe. Insoles Our philosophy with footwear is to let the shoes do what they are designed to do. Sometimes a runner just needs more; more cushion or more arch support. We have insoles with more cushion and full length and ¾ length arch supports. We also have heel lifts and metatarsal pads. Nutrition A runner needs as much as 50 grams of carbohydrate for every hour of endurance exercise for optimal performance. Energy gel packs have approximately 25 grams of carbs in a 1.2 to 1.5 ounce serving. They are easy to carry on your runs and will help keep you from bonking.

Hydration The key to performance and recovery begins with proper hydration. An average runner can lose several ounces of fluid from perspiration every mile. One solution to dehydration is to bring the fluids with you. Heart rate monitors are the most effective tool runners can use to maximize workouts while reducing the risk of injuries caused from over-training. Eye wear Eyewear20 years ago, only the fast, cocky runners wore sunglasses while running. Today, more runners understand the need to protect our eyes from harmful UV light during the run. Lens quality and visual clarity at all angles of view is important on high end running eye wear. More runners are using low light lenses for trail running. This adds contrast and helps intensify the trail, while protecting the eyes from and occasional low hanging tree branch.
